|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small repair or patching |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Partial wall replacement | $4,500 - $8,000 |
| Full wall rebuild | $10,000 - $20,000 |
| Foundation stabilization | $12,000 - $25,000 |
| Stone wall restoration | $3,000 - $7,000 |
| Custom stonework |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Repointing and sealing | $2,000 - $4,500 |
Factors Influencing Cost
Stone wall repair in Jersey City, NJ, involves restoring or replacing existing stone structures that have experienced damage or deterioration. The scope of work can vary from small sections to extensive rebuilds, depending on the condition of the wall.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and comparing options for stone wall repairs in the area.
- Materials: Replacements often use natural or reclaimed Jersey City stones, with options for mortar types suited to historic or modern aesthetics.
- Size and Scope: Projects may range from minor repairs on small sections to large-scale rebuilding of entire walls, influencing overall complexity.
- Labor Complexity: Repairing stone walls requires skilled craftsmanship, especially for matching stones and ensuring structural stability.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Jersey City may require permits for extensive repairs or modifications to existing stone structures.
- Extras: Additional features such as drainage solutions, decorative caps, or reinforcement can add to project scope and cost.
